CATALOG NAME: Knee Brace
TYPE: SEAM

This custom component allows you to quickly add a knee brace between a beam and a column as well as the connections for the braces and the beam to column. The picking order defines the direction of the brace, which can consist of single or double angle braces. You can apply this component to both the top and bottom of the same beam.


Picking order:

1.  Select column
2.  Select beam 
3.  Select the start or end handle of the beam reference line
4.  Pick a point along the column reference line to define the brace direction


Component Options:

1.  You can define whether the brace angle is required on the near side (NS), far side (FS), or both sides (BS) of the beam centreline.
2.  You will need to specify the gusset plate thickness to offset the bracing angles. This cannot be read from the nested angle brace connections.


Connections:

1.  You cannot apply this component to a beam that already has a connection component to the column. There is an option inside this component to define the beam to column connection component and attribute file.
2.  You can define whether or not to create the brace connections, and if required, specify which component and attribute to use.
3.  When you pick braces to be on both sides, you need to define which component and attribute file to use to create the double angle braces (uses the Double Angle (Equal) custom component, standard attribute by default)
4.  When you pick braces to be on both sides, you will need to create the connections in the model after the knee brace component has been created.


Brace Geometry:

1.  You can define the brace geometry by either defining the X and Y dimensions, or by defining one of these dimensions along with the desired angle of the brace, and the component will automatically calculate the other dimension.
2.   You can check the actual angle of the brace by double clicking on an existing component in the model.
